扁平化设计|创新视界|区块链应用开发

创意理念提示

这是一个网页样式设计参考,采用了冷色系与暖色点缀相结合的设计风格。

关键特性

扁平化设计赋能区块链应用的创新视界

在技术与设计交融的时代,如何通过网页样式设计传达复杂的技术理念,同时保持用户体验的直观性?本文将探讨如何利用扁平化设计风格和前端技术实现,为区块链应用开发注入新的活力。

色彩搭配:科技感与信任感并存

扁平化设计的核心之一在于色彩的选择。为了体现区块链技术的专业性和透明性,建议使用冷色系为主调,如蓝色和灰色,象征科技与信任。辅以橙色和绿色作为点缀,用于突出关键信息或操作按钮。


/* 示例代码:定义主色调 */
:root {
    --primary-color: #0074D9; /* 蓝色 */
    --secondary-color: #FF851B; /* 橙色 */
    --accent-color: #2ECC40;   /* 绿色 */
}

body {
    background-color: #F5F5F5;
    color: #333;
}

通过 CSS 变量设置主色调,不仅方便维护,还能够快速调整整体配色方案。

排版设计:现代无衬线字体确保可读性

选择简洁现代的无衬线字体,例如 Roboto 或 Montserrat,可以提升文字的清晰度与科技感。标题和重要信息应采用较粗的字体权重,而正文则使用适中的字体大小,确保内容层次分明。


/* 示例代码:定义字体与文本样式 */
body {
    font-family: 'Roboto', sans-serif;
    line-height: 1.6;
    letter-spacing: 0.5px;
}

h1, h2, h3 {
    font-weight: bold;
    margin-bottom: 1em;
}

p {
    font-size: 16px;
    font-weight: normal;
}

此外,适当的行高(line-height)和字距(letter-spacing)设置能进一步优化阅读体验。

布局结构:模块化与响应式网格系统

采用响应式网格系统进行布局,是扁平化设计的关键组成部分。通过模块化设计,每个功能块都可以独立展示,便于用户快速浏览和理解。


/* 示例代码:定义响应式网格布局 */
.container {
    display: grid;
    grid-template-columns: repeat(auto-fit, minmax(200px, 1fr));
    gap: 20px;
}

.module {
    background-color: #FFFFFF;
    padding: 20px;
    border-radius: 8px;
    box-shadow: 0 4px 6px rgba(0, 0, 0, 0.1);
}

以上代码展示了如何利用 CSS Grid 创建灵活的布局结构,并通过阴影效果增强视觉层次感。

图标与图形:简约且辨识度高的矢量设计

矢量图标在扁平化设计中扮演着重要角色。使用线条简洁、形状明确的图标,可以有效传递信息而不增加视觉负担。

图标类型 应用场景
链条 表示区块链连接
节点 象征网络分布
数据块 代表信息存储

通过表格列举不同类型的图标及其用途,可以帮助设计师更好地选择合适的视觉元素。

动画与互动:微动效提升用户体验

适度的动画效果可以显著提升用户的参与感。以下是一些常见的交互动效:

  1. 按钮悬停时颜色变化
  2. 滚动页面时元素渐显
  3. 加载过程中显示简洁动画

/* 示例代码:定义按钮悬停效果 */
button {
    background-color: var(--primary-color);
    color: #FFFFFF;
    transition: background-color 0.3s ease;
}

button:hover {
    background-color: var(--secondary-color);
}

上述代码实现了按钮在鼠标悬停时的颜色过渡效果,增强了交互体验。

视觉元素:融合区块链核心概念

为了强化区块链技术的透明性和高效性,可以在设计中融入数据流、网络节点等抽象几何图形。这些元素不仅能突出现代感,还能帮助用户更直观地理解复杂的概念。

CSS 实现动态数据可视化

通过 CSS 动画模拟数据流动的效果:


/* 示例代码:创建数据流动画 */
.data-flow {
    width: 100%;
    height: 10px;
    background: linear-gradient(to right, #0074D9, #FF851B);
    animation: flow 2s infinite;
}

@keyframes flow {
    0% { transform: translateX(-100%); }
    100% { transform: translateX(100%); }
}

此代码片段展示了如何使用 CSS 动画制作循环移动的数据流效果。

总结:平衡功能与美学

扁平化设计不仅是一种视觉风格,更是对用户体验的深刻思考。通过合理的色彩搭配、简洁的排版、模块化的布局以及适度的动画效果,我们可以为区块链应用打造一个既直观又高效的界面。

这种设计方法不仅满足了功能需求,还通过创新的视觉表现手法,提升了品牌的市场竞争力。无论是在供应链管理还是金融服务领域,扁平化设计都能够帮助用户轻松上手,同时感受到技术的力量与设计的温度。

示例场景展示

关键词与标签

扁平化设计
创新视界
区块链应用
用户体验
技术展示